Some people believe that it is a good idea that older people continue to work if it is possible for them to do.

Do you agree or disagree?

The relationship between work and age is often complicated. While I think that the elderly should retire and devote time to their hobbies, I would have to agree with the notion that they should keep working if possible.

On the one hand, the majority of older adults often fail to adapt to a fast-changing society and would be better off enjoying the pleasures of their retirement. This is true since most businesses nowadays, such as medicine or engineering, require their employees to have a certain degree of expertise, and the elderly often struggle to meet such standards. If they have to work, they will feel obsolete and discouraged. Rather than that, if possible, seniors should use their savings to spend time relaxing or participating in other pastimes they love. For instance, many retirees use their remaining time and health to improve their skills, such as gardening, crafting, or painting. They may then express themselves more effectively and discover new interests in life.

However, because their mental and physical aging processes are slow, many older adults still find their work rewarding. There are several cases of senior citizens working in highly demanding industries such as technology, science, medication, design, or acting and feeling good about themselves. Moreover, not all the elderly are financially self-sufficient or adequately supported by their offspring, creating the need for additional income from labor. Thus, without a job, most older people will experience feelings of worthlessness, disorientation, and insecurity.

In conclusion, though it is true that some older adults should retire with dignity and pursue other interests, I agree that the majority of elderly citizens should continue to work if possible. Additionally, the government should make proper efforts to assist the elderly in finding work. (288 words)
